New Qass Optimizer Technology Delivers Control of Consumable Tooling Costs Qass Technologies announces the development of the QASS Optimizer which was designed to provide a solution for manufacturing facilities that have consumable tooling costs in end-mills, reamers, drills and others. Arlington Heights, IL (PRWEB) June 22, 2009 -- Qass Technologies announces the development of the QASS Optimizer. (http://www.qasstechnologies.com/) The Optimizer was designed to provide a solution for manufacturing facilities that have consumable tooling costs in end-mills, reamers, drills, etc. By utilizing patented Acoustic (AE) technology housed in a single, user-friendly unit, the Optimizer enables users to acquire valuable data on tool usage in order to maximize performance and predictable wear.
Unlike other "metrology" instruments, QASS Optimizer is manufactured for the production floor. QASS Optimizer technology provides the following user benefits: • Establishment of a base line for predicting tool wear for any process • Virtual elimination of scrap and re-works because of tool damage • Optimization of feed and speed rates to maximize all aspects in real-time production • Measurable in-process parameters for easy, fast adjustments after the first few cuts
End-users of the QASS Optimizer will experience a drastic reduction in setup times while reducing tool wear and breakage. This enables manageable, predictable consumable tooling costs resulting in increased machine up-time and reduced maintenance.
The portable unit can be used in a multi-machine work environment and consists of simple plug & play operation, user-friendly screens and real-time monitoring that interfaces with most machine control units.
